İlişkisel veritabanı yapısı

Veritabanı ve veritabanı yapısı kuruluş işleminde tanımlanır. Veritabanının yapısı veritabanının Oracle Database, IBM® Db2®ya da Microsoft™ SQL Serverolup olmadığına bağlıdır.

Bir tablo kümesi olarak algılanabilen ve ilişkisel veri modeline göre işlenebilecek bir veri tabanı. Her veritabanı aşağıdakileri içerir:
  • verilerin mantıksal ve fiziksel yapısını tanımlayan sistem kataloğu çizelgeleri kümesi
  • Veritabanı için ayrılan parametre değerlerini içeren bir yapılandırma dosyası
  • Sürekli işlemler ve arşivlenebilir işlemler içeren bir kurtarma günlüğü
Tablo 1. Veritabanı sıradüzeni
Bileşen Açıklama
Veri Sözlüğü Bir kuruluşa ilişkin uygulama programları, veritabanları, mantıksal veri modelleri ve yetkiler hakkında bilgi havuzu.

Veri sözlüğünü değiştirdiğinizde, değişiklik işlemi, veri sözlüğünün bozulmasını önleyebilecek düzenleme denetimlerini içerir. Bir veri sözlüğünü kurtarmanın tek yolu, bir yedekten geri yüklemektir.

Taşıyıcı Veritabanı tanımlamak için kullanılan bir dosya, dizin ya da aygıt gibi veri depolama konumu.
Depolama Bölümü Bir veritabanındaki mantıksal depolama birimi; örneğin, kapların toplanması. Veritabanı depolama bölümleri, Db2 ve Oracle, ve SQL Server içinde dosya grupları olarak çağrıldıiçinde çizelge alanları olarak adlandırılır.
İş Nesnesi Bir uygulama içinde, kullanıcıların bir kullanım senaryosu gerçekleştirirken oluşturdukları, bunlara erişdikleri ve bunları işledikleri somut bir varlık. Bir sistem içindeki iş nesneleri genellikle durumlu, kalıcı ve uzun ömürlü olur. İş nesneleri iş verilerini içerir ve iş davranışını modeller.
Veri tabanı nesnesi Yönetim ortamı, veritabanı, veritabanı bölümü grubu, arabellek havuzu, çizelge ya da dizin gibi bir veritabanı sistemi kuruluşunda var olan bir nesne. Bir veritabanı nesnesi verileri bulundurur ve herhangi bir davranışı yoktur.
Tablo Belirli bir konuya ilişkin bir veri toplamasını bulunduran veritabanı nesnesi. Tablolar satır ve sütunlardan oluşur.
Sütun Veritabanı çizelgesinin düşey bileşeni. Bir kolonun bir adı ve belirli bir veri tipi vardır; örneğin, karakter, ondalık ya da tamsayı.
Satır Çizelgenin, çizelgenin her kolonu için bir değer sırası içeren yatay bileşeni.
Görünüm Temel tablo kümesinde depolanan verileri temel alan bir mantıksal tablo. Bir görünümün döndürdüğü veriler, temel çizelgelerde çalıştırılan bir SELECT deyimi tarafından belirlenir.
Dizin Bir anahtarın değerlerine göre mantıksal olarak sıralanan işaretçiler kümesi. Dizinler, verilere hızlı erişim sağlar ve çizelgedeki satırlara ilişkin anahtar değerlerinin benzersizliğini zorlayabilir.
İlişki Bir birleştirme deyimi belirtilerek yaratılan bir ya da daha çok nesne arasındaki bağlantı.
Birleştir Genellikle birleştirme kolonlarını belirten bir birleştirme koşuluna dayalı olarak, verilerin iki çizelgeden alınabileceği bir SQL ilişkisel işlemi.